Specifications
Product Category : | Ceramic Capacitors | Manufacturer : | KEMET |
Applications : | General Purpose | Capacitance : | 0.15µF |
Failure Rate : | - | Features : | Low ESL |
Height - Seated (Max) : | 0.400" (10.16mm) | Lead Spacing : | 0.200" (5.08mm) |
Lead Style : | Formed Leads - Kinked | Mounting Type : | Through Hole |
Operating Temperature : | -55°C ~ 125°C | Package / Case : | Radial |
Packaging : | Tape & Reel (TR) | Part Status : | Active |
Ratings : | - | Series : | Goldmax, 300 |
Size / Dimension : | 0.280" L x 0.160" W (7.11mm x 4.07mm) | Temperature Coefficient : | C0G, NP0 |
Thickness (Max) : | - | Tolerance : | ±1% |
Voltage - Rated : | 200V |
